本文目录导读:
数据仓库概述
数据仓库是一个集成了历史数据、实时数据以及业务数据的数据库系统,用于支持企业级的数据分析和决策,数据仓库具有以下特点:
图片来源于网络,如有侵权联系删除
1、面向主题:数据仓库以主题为中心,将企业内部和外部数据按照主题进行整合。
2、面向分析:数据仓库的数据经过清洗、转换和集成,以满足数据分析的需求。
3、面向时间:数据仓库存储历史数据,并支持对历史数据的查询和分析。
4、非易失性:数据仓库的数据一旦存储,将不再修改,以保证数据的准确性和一致性。
数据仓库基本操作
1、数据采集
数据采集是数据仓库建设的首要步骤,主要包括以下操作:
(1)数据源识别:识别企业内部和外部数据源,如数据库、日志文件、外部接口等。
(2)数据抽取:根据数据源的特点,采用ETL(Extract-Transform-Load)技术,从数据源中抽取数据。
(3)数据清洗:对抽取的数据进行清洗,包括去除重复数据、修正错误数据、填充缺失数据等。
(4)数据转换:将清洗后的数据进行转换,如数据格式转换、数据类型转换等。
图片来源于网络,如有侵权联系删除
2、数据存储
数据存储是数据仓库的核心,主要包括以下操作:
(1)数据库设计:根据数据仓库的架构和需求,设计合适的数据库结构,如表结构、索引、视图等。
(2)数据加载:将清洗和转换后的数据加载到数据库中,可采用批量加载或实时加载。
(3)数据分区:根据数据的特点,对数据进行分区,以提高查询效率。
(4)数据压缩:对存储的数据进行压缩,以节省存储空间。
3、数据查询
数据查询是数据仓库的最终目的,主要包括以下操作:
(1)SQL查询:使用SQL语句进行数据查询,包括简单查询、连接查询、子查询等。
(2)数据可视化:将查询结果以图表、地图等形式展示,方便用户理解。
图片来源于网络,如有侵权联系删除
(3)多维分析:对数据进行多维分析,如时间序列分析、空间分析等。
4、数据维护
数据维护是保证数据仓库正常运行的重要环节,主要包括以下操作:
(1)数据备份:定期对数据仓库进行备份,以防止数据丢失。
(2)数据清理:定期清理无效、过期数据,以提高数据质量。
(3)性能优化:根据数据仓库的运行情况,对数据库进行性能优化。
(4)安全性管理:对数据仓库进行安全性管理,防止数据泄露。
数据仓库是现代企业不可或缺的一部分,掌握数据仓库的基本操作对于企业的发展具有重要意义,通过数据采集、数据存储、数据查询和数据维护等基本操作,企业可以高效构建和管理数据宝库,为决策提供有力支持,在实际操作中,还需根据企业需求和技术水平,不断优化数据仓库的架构和性能,以满足企业的发展需求。
标签: #数据仓库基本操作
评论列表